Abstract

Bell towers are slender structures of variable dimensions that are highly subjected to seismic damage due to their structural characteristics. The seismic response of bell towers and the design of potential retrofit interventions depend on their configuration, either isolated or connected to other constructions making part of ecclesiastic complexes. The different seismic behavior of bell towers depending or less from the interaction with other structures is evaluated in the current work, which analyses a case study of a RC tower inserted within a masonry church placed in the municipality of Torre del Greco, in the district of Naples (Italy). Three different macro-element models of the RC bell tower developed with the 3MURI software are considered: the tower alone, the tower together with the masonry structure just below its vertical projection and the tower including the whole volume of the church. Whereas the isolated model overestimates the bell tower seismic capacity, modelling of other structural part allows to obtain more reliable prediction of the real behavior of the tower. Based on the achieved seismic response, a suitable retrofit intervention with C-FRP fibers is planned for seismic upgrading of the tower through improvement of the performance of beams and columns under bending moment, shear and axial loads. The effectiveness of retrofit interventions is performed both locally, by performing the verification of structural sections, and globally, by analyzing the seismic behavior of the entire ecclesiastic complex.
